For 25 years, IDeaS has been helping the world’s hospitality businesses maximize their revenue performance. IDeaS Revenue Solutions - a SAS Company, offers industry-leading pricing and revenue management Software, Services, and Consulting to the hospitality and travel industries. We've been called on by industries as far-ranging as parking, airlines, transportation and event ticketing.

Headquartered in Minneapolis, MN with our Global Technology center located in Pune, India, IDeaS maintains sales, support and distribution offices in North & South America, the United Kingdom, Europe, Middle East, Africa, Australia and Asia. Job Overview & Requirements
IDeaS, a SAS company, has an outstanding opportunity for a Client Training Specialist.  This position is based from our Shanghai, China office.  As a Client Training Specialist, you will be responsible for providing face to face training, remote training and assistance for clients working with the IDeaS suite of products, in support of company and department goals.  IDeaS Client Training Specialists bring innovation and clarity to the client’s experience with IDeaS Solutions and set the stage for a strong ongoing relationship.

 

For this role, you will have the opportunity to…

• Provide clear and concise face-to-face conceptual and operational IDeaS solution(s) training to hotel clients using IDeaS approved training materials
• Delivery of remote training sessions to individuals and groups using tools such as Webex
• Provide assistance in configuring the IDeaS systems at client sites in order to ensure that the client is able to experience maximum benefit from the installation of the system
• Provide assistance and guidance to clients in effectively integrating the IDeaS System into the hotel operation and company culture
• Listen and process complex requirements from clients across different cultures and levels within the client’s organization in ‘real time’
• Delivery of detailed status and summary reports to the IDeaS team following each training assignment in line with standardized timelines
• Ensure that all materials presented to the client meet set format standards and convey professionalism and clarity
• Identification of areas where further training may be required at a client site in order for the users to obtain the maximum benefits from the IDeaS System
• Participation in the development and review of effective training materials
• Provide consultation to Hotels in regards to business practices directly related to the use of the IDeaS system
• Delivery of in-house training to other members of the IDeaS team and mentoring of new members of the Client Training Specialist team
• Demonstration of the IDeaS System and IDeaS concepts in a sales environment during client visits or trade shows
• Liaison with instructional design and learning management system team
• Performs other duties, as assigned.
